The XREAL One Pro is the most advanced pair of smart glasses for power users, designed to replace traditional multi-monitor setups with a massive 57-degree field of view. This device features integrated 3DOF tracking, allowing the screen to stay anchored in space, and "Widescreen Mode," which creates a virtual 3,840-by-1,920 desktop. The XREAL One Pro also boasts electrochromic dimmable lenses for instant immersion.
Another notable smart glasses model is the RayNeo Air 4 Pro, which has disrupted the market by offering HDR10 support and Bang & Olufsen-tuned audio at a highly competitive price point. This device features a 1,200-nit HDR10 display, 120Hz refresh rate for gaming, and 3840Hz PWM dimming to reduce eye strain.
Lastly, the Oakley Meta HSTN is a social media powerhouse built specifically for creators who want to document their live experiences. This device looks nearly identical to classic Wayfarers but functions as a complete hands-free communication and streaming hub.
